For operation of the distributed lock manager (DLM) software with Oracle Parallel Server 7.3.x, you set DLM_ENABLED to YES and GMS_ENABLED to NO, then define two sets of parameters — cluster interface parameters and DLM lock database parameters. The DLM lock database parameters relate to the number of Oracle resources and the number of Oracle processes in the OPS configuration; these values should be chosen in consultation with the Oracle DBA. Refer to your Oracle documentation for additional information.

Cluster Interface Specific DLM Parameters

Cluster-specific DLM parameters are stored along with other cluster information in the binary cluster configuration file, which is located on all nodes in the cluster. These parameters can be entered by using SAM or by editing the cluster configuration template file created by issuing the cmquerycl command, as described in the chapter "Chapter 5 “Building an OPS Cluster Configuration”."

Appropriate values must be identified for the following DLM cluster interface parameters:

GMS Enabled

Set this parameter to NO when using OPS version 7.3.x. Default: NO.

In the ASCII cluster configuration file, this parameter is known as GMS_ENABLED.

DLM Enabled

When set to YES, the DLM starts in the cluster when the cluster starts or reboots. Set to NO if you wish not to start up OPS/DLM when the cluster is started. Default: NO.

In the ASCII cluster configuration file, this parameter is known as DLM_ENABLED.

DLM Connect Timeout

The upper bound on time available for the DLM to initialize its shared memory on startup. Default: 30 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_CONNECT_TIMEOUT.

DLM Halt Timeout

The upper bound on time available to execute the OPS halt scripts. Default: 180 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_HALT_TIMEOUT.

Ping Interval

Interval at which the cluster manager sends messages to the DLM to check the status of its health. Default: 20 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_PING_INTERVAL.

Ping Timeout

Time after which the cluster manager assumes that the DLM is not active. Default: 60 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_PING_TIMEOUT.

Reconfiguration Timeout

The number of seconds that the Cluster Manager should wait for the DLM to start or reconfigure before assuming the failure of the DLM. Default: 300 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_RECONFIG_TIMEOUT.

Communication Fail Timeout

Time after which the cluster manager assumes that no reconfiguration will take place and takes action on a DLM communication failure. Default: 270 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_COMMFAIL_TIMEOUT.

DLM Halt Timeout

The upper bound on time available to execute the OPS halt scripts. Default: 240 seconds.

In the ASCII cluster configuration file, this parameter is known as DLM_HALT_TIMEOUT.

Distributed lock manager planning can be done using the SAM high availability options, which let you display defaults or lists of acceptable values for the parameters listed above. Enter the appropriate values shown in the SAM display onto your DLM configuration worksheet. If you are unsure of what value to use for a parameter, start with the default.

DLM Internal Parameters

DLM internal parameters are stored in the binary DLM configuration file, which is located on all nodes in the cluster. These parameters can be entered by using SAM or by editing the DLM configuration template file created by issuing the dlmquery command, as described in the chapter "Chapter 5 “Building an OPS Cluster Configuration”." The defaults are sufficient for the Oracle demo database, but you should adjust these parameters according to the size of your development or production system.

NOTE: Note that values for DLM resources can change between OPS releases. Consult your Oracle documentation for the version of OPS you are using to obtain the correct values.

Appropriate values must be identified for the following:

Cluster Name

This is the same as the cluster name you use in cluster manager configuration.

In the ASCII DLM configuration file, this parameter is known as CLUSTER_NAME.

Processes

The maximum number of DLM processes that may run on the cluster. This is roughly equivalent to the number of Oracle processes that run concurrently on both nodes. The parameter has to be changed if the sum of the Oracle PROCESSES parameters in the two instances (one for each node) exceeds 2200. The DLM default, which is 2400, will have to be increased to leave some margin for miscellaneous additional processes.

In the ASCII DLM configuration file, this parameter is known as MAXPROCESSES.

Resources

This is the total number of distributed locks for which memory must be allocated in an OPS on HP-UX system. The default is 6000.

A list of the actual values of the PROCESSES, MAXRESOURCES, and MAXLOCKS parameters used by the DLM is found in /var/opt/dlm/logs/dlmstart.log. Consult the Oracle Parallel Server for HP 9000 Servers Addendum for the formula for computing MAXRESOURCES and MAXLOCKS.

In the ASCII DLM configuration file, this parameter is known as MAXRESOURCES.

Locks

The size of the DLM lock database. This is a value based on an Oracle configuration parameter known as DLM_RSRCS. The default is 2*(Resources) or 12000.

A list of the actual values of the PROCESSES, MAXRESOURCES, and MAXLOCKS parameters used by the DLM is found in /var/opt/dlm/logs/dlmstart.log. Consult the Oracle Parallel Server for HP 9000 Servers Addendum for the formula for computing MAXRESOURCES and MAXLOCKS. In the ASCII DLM configuration file, this parameter is known as MAXLOCKS.

Deadlock Detection Interval

Interval at which the DLM sends messages to determine whether deadlock has occurred between nodes. Default: 3 seconds.

In the ASCII DLM configuration file, this parameter is known as DEADLOCK_DETECTION_INTERVAL.

DLM Monitor Interval

The interval at which the DLM monitors client processes. On discovering a dead client process, the DLM carries out lock recovery. The default interval is 3 seconds.

In the ASCII DLM configuration file, this parameter is known as the PROCESS_MONITORING_INTERVAL.

Subnet Address

The subnet address of the LAN used for inter-DLM messages passed between OPS instances. By default, this is the same as the subnet used for the cluster manager heartbeat messages. If you wish to separate heartbeat traffic from DLM message traffic, select a different monitored subnet address for DLM than you chose for heartbeats in the basic cluster configuration.

This value is used in configuring the DLM with SAM.

Node Name(s)

These are the same as the node names you use in cluster manager configuration.

In the ASCII DLM configuration file, this parameter is known as NODE_NAME. Use a separate entry for each node paired with an IPADDR.

DLM Node IP Addresses

The IP addresses of each node's interface to the DLM subnet. Must be consistent with the subnet address. By default, this is the same as the IP address used for cluster heartbeat on this node, but if you wish to separate DLM message traffic from cluster heartbeat traffic, you can specify an IP address on a different monitored subnet than the one you chose for heartbeats in the basic cluster configuration. This value is used only when configuring the DLM by editing DLM configuration files.

In the ASCII DLM configuration file, this parameter is known as IPADDR. Use a separate entry for each node immediately following the NODE_NAME.

Distributed lock manager planning can be done using the SAM high availability options, which let you display defaults or lists of acceptable values for the parameters listed above. Enter the appropriate values shown in the SAM display onto your DLM configuration worksheet. If you are unsure of what value to use for a parameter, start with the default.

Setting HP-UX Shared Memory Allocation

Based on the needs of your system, you may need to adjust the total amount of memory to provide enough lockable memory for the DLM, as well as for Oracle programs and the cluster daemon processes. The default values of the PROCESSES, MAXRESOURCES and MAXLOCKS parameters (2400, 6000 and 12000 respectively) require the DLM to configure a shared memory segment, locked in core, of about 5 Mbytes on each node. For each increment of 5000 in the PROCESSES parameter, an extra 1.6 Mbyte of memory will be required for the DLM shared memory segment. For each increment by 5000 in the MAXRESOURCES parameter (assuming MAXLOCKS is increased by 10000 to be twice the increased RESOURCES value) the corresponding increase in the DLM shared memory segment is 3.5 Mbytes.

A list of the actual values of the PROCESSES, MAXRESOURCES, and MAXLOCKS parameters used by the DLM is found in /var/opt/dlm/logs/dlmstart.log. Consult the Oracle Parallel Server for HP 9000 Servers Addendum for the formula for computing MAXRESOURCES and MAXLOCKS.

DLM Configuration Worksheet (OPS 7.3.x)

Fill out this worksheet in cooperation with your HP-UX system administrator and Oracle database administrator. Figure 4-6 “DLM Configuration Worksheet” is a sample worksheet filled out. Refer to the appendix, "Appendix E “Blank Planning Worksheets ”" for samples of blank worksheets. Make as many copies as you need. Fill out the worksheet and keep it for future reference.

Figure 4-6 DLM Configuration Worksheet

 Cluster-Specific Parameters:
 
        DLM Enabled:  ____YES_________________________
 
        GMS Enabled: _____NO__________________
 
        Reconfig Timeout: __60 sec________________
 
        Ping Interval: __10 sec___________________
 
        Ping Timeout: __30 sec____________________
 
        DLM Connect Timeout: _ 30 sec________________
 
        DLM Halt Timeout: __180 sec________________
 
        Communication Fail Timeout: _120 sec_______________
    ==============================================================================
    Internal DLM Parameters:
 
        Cluster Name: ___opscluster___________________
 
        Node Name(s): ___node1, node2_________________
 
        Resources: __6000_________________________
 
        Locks: __12000____________________________
 
        Processes: _2400__________________________
 
        Deadlock Detection Interval _3 sec_________________________
 
        DLM Monitor Interval _3 sec___________________________
 
        Subnet Address: _192.6.143.0______
 
        Node 1 IP Address: __192.6.143.30____
 
.       Node 2 IP Address: __192.6.143.31____
